Yes, batteries can corrode, especially if they are left in appliances for long periods or are damaged. This corrosion is the result of electrolyte leakage, which reacts with the metal parts and the air, forming a corrosive deposit.
In most cases corrosion occurs in zinc and-carbon batteries and alkaline, and alkaline batteries can leak over time. The electrolyte contained in such batteries is usually potassium hydroxide or ammonium chloride - chemically reactive substances. When a battery is discharged or stored in poor conditions (e.g. in high humidity), can lead to enclosures leak, and electrolyte starts to leak out. Contact with air and metallic parts results in the appearance of a white or bluish deposit, which is a sign of corrosion.
Yes, but to a limited extent. Although corrosion of Batteries does not cause violent chemical reactions, but substances contained in the spill can be corrosive to the skin and can damage electronics. It is therefore very important, not to ignore visible signs of battery damage and to regularly check the condition of battery-powered devices.
If you notice corrosion in a device, first of all unplug the device and remove the Batteries. Then wear protective gloves - even homemade latex or nitrile gloves - to avoid contact with the electrolyte. To neutralise the deposits, it is best to use a solution of vinegar or lemon juice, which reacts with alkaline electrolyte residues, dissolving them. It is sufficient to gently wipe the affected areas with a cotton bud or a cloth soaked in the solution. After cleaning, dry the area and check the following, that there is no permanent damage to the tracks, contacts or plastic parts. If the metal contacts are more deeply damaged, they may need to be sanded or even replaced.
IMPORTANT: Do not attempt to use the device, before it has been thoroughly cleaned and checked.
The best way is to regularly check the condition of batteries, especially in devices that are used infrequently. Batteries should also be removed from devices, remove batteries from devices that are to be stored for long periods. Using branded cells and avoiding overcharging or completely discharging them also reduces the risk of chemical damage.
IMPORTANT: If you are not sure, whether a device is still usable after a battery leak, consult a qualified service technician or electronics technician. Improper cleaning may aggravate damage or lead to further corrosion.
Transfer Multisort Elektronik (TME) is one of the world’s largest global distributors of electronic components, electrotechnical parts, workshop equipment, and industrial automation. The catalog includes over 1,500,000 products from 1,300 leading manufacturers. TME’s modern logistics centers in Łódź and Rzgów (Poland), with a combined area of over 40,000 m², ship nearly 6,000 packages daily to customers in more than 150 countries.
TME also invests in the development of knowledge and skills of young engineers and electronics enthusiasts through the TME Education project, and supports the tech community by organizing the TechMasterEvent series, promoting innovation and experience exchange.
